Choosing the appropriate emulator for your tasks
The emulation software market is oversaturated with offers, and it is easy for a beginner to get confused in the variety of brands. The key factor when choosing should be the purpose of the device: if you are a gamer, macro support and high frame rates are important to you, while developers need a clean environment and debugging tools ADB. The segment leaders remain BlueStacks, NoxPlayer and LDPlayer, each of which has its own unique advantages.
Some users prefer less resource-intensive solutions, such as MEmu Play or KoPlayer, which can work even on older laptops with integrated graphics. However, it is worth considering that saving resources is often achieved by reducing functionality or having built-in advertising. For corporate tasks or testing specific software, it is sometimes advisable to use official tools from Google, although their installation may be more complicated.
⚠️ Attention: Avoid downloading emulators from unverified torrent trackers or file hosting services. Official developer sites are the only safe place to download installation packages, as modified versions often contain miners or spyware.
When evaluating candidates, pay attention to the version of Android they emulate. Most modern games require at least Android 7 Nougat or Android 9 Pie to work correctly. Outdated emulators based on Android 4 or 5 may simply not launch new applications from Google Play.
Preparing the system and activating virtualization
Before running the installer, you need to make sure that your hardware is ready to work with virtual machines. The central element here is virtualization technology known as VT-x for Intel processors or AMD-V for Ryzen chips. Without enabling this function in the BIOS, the emulator will work extremely slowly or will not start at all.
You can check the virtualization status in Windows 10 through the Task Manager. Press the key combination Ctrl + Shift + Esc, go to the “Performance” tab and select the “CPU” section. In the lower right corner of the window you will see the line “Virtualization”, where the status should be “Enabled”. If it says “Disabled”, you will need to reboot and enter the BIOS settings.

Entering the BIOS is done by pressing the key Del, F2 or F10 immediately after turning on the computer. Interfaces for different motherboard manufacturers differ, but usually the settings are located in the Advanced, CPU Configuration or Securitysections. Find the item Intel Virtualization Technology or SVM Mode and switch it to the value Enabled.
You should also make sure that there is enough free space on drive C:. Emulators not only take up space for the installer itself, but also create virtual disk images that can grow to several gigabytes as applications are installed. It is recommended to have a reserve of at least 10-15 GB for comfortable work.

Performance settings and resource allocation
Successful installation - this is only half the battle. For comfortable work, you need to correctly distribute the resources of your PC between the main system and the virtual machine. Go to the emulator settings (usually the gear icon) and find the “Engine” or “Performance” section. Here you can configure the number of processor cores and the amount of RAM.
The optimal choice for most modern computers is to allocate 2 or 4 CPU cores and 4 GB of RAM. If you have a weak PC with 8 GB of total memory, limit yourself to 2 GB for the emulator so as not to cause slowdowns in Windows itself. For powerful gaming stations, you can allocate more, but never give the virtual machine all available resources.
| PC configuration | CPU cores | RAM (RAM) | Graphics mode |
|---|---|---|---|
| Office PC (4 cores, 8 GB) | 2 | 2048 MB | Compatibility |
| Medium gaming (6 cores, 16 GB) | 4 | 4096 MB | Performance |
| Powerful station (8+ cores, 32 GB) | 6 | 8192 MB | High Performance |
| Weak laptop (2 cores, 4 GB) | 1 | 1024 MB | Low Memory |
Pay special attention to the graphics settings. Most emulators have a choice between rendering modes: OpenGL and DirectX. If you have a video card from NVIDIA or AMDOpenGL mode usually provides better compatibility with games. For integrated graphics Intel HD sometimes DirectX works more stable.
Don't forget to check the screen resolution. Running the emulator in the native resolution of your monitor (for example 1920×1080) can heavily load the system. For games, it is often enough to set the resolution 1280×720, which will significantly increase FPS without significant loss of visual quality on the PC screen.
What is DPI and how to change it?
DPI (dots per inch) affects the size of icons and text inside the emulator. The standard value is 240. Increasing to 320 or 400 will make the interface larger and clearer, which is convenient on 4K monitors, but can reduce performance in heavy games.
Solving common problems and conflicts
Even if you follow all the instructions, users may encounter errors at startup. One of the most common problems is a black screen or endless loading. This often indicates a conflict with other virtualization apps, such as the one built into Windows 10 Pro. To resolve this issue, you must disable Hyper-V. Open Control Panel, go to apps and Features, then Turn Windows features on or off. Find it in the list Hyper-V, which is built into Windows 10 Pro.

If the emulator crashes immediately after launch, check that your video card drivers are up to date. Manufacturers regularly release updates to improve compatibility with emulators. Go to the website of your GPU manufacturer (NVIDIA, AMD or Intel) and download the latest version of the software.
⚠️ Attention: A port conflict may occur if another emulator or service that uses port 5555 is already running on the PC. In the emulator settings, you can change the ADB port number to avoid collision.
In cases where games do not work correctly or textures are displayed incorrectly, try switching the rendering mode in the emulator settings. Sometimes changing the priority of the emulator process in the Task Manager to “High” helps, but do not set it to “Real Time”, as this can block the operation of the mouse and keyboard.

Management and synchronization with a mobile device
One of the main advantages of using an emulator on a PC is the possibility of convenient control. The keyboard and mouse provide precision not available with touch screens. Most emulators have a built-in key manager that allows you to assign actions to any buttons.
For first-person shooters, you can set motion controls to keys WASD, and aiming to move the mouse. For strategies, it is convenient to set up hotkeys for quick construction or calling up menus. These profiles can be saved and switched depending on the game you are running.
Data synchronization is also an important aspect. The easiest way to transfer applications is to log into your Google account inside the emulator. All purchased applications and saves (if the game supports cloud saves) will be downloaded automatically. To transfer files, you can use a shared folder or simply drag the file .apk to the emulator window.
Some advanced emulators support multitasking, allowing you to run multiple copies of Android at the same time. This is useful for farmers in online games or for running multiple social media accounts. However, remember that each additional instance consumes resources in proportion to the first.

Frequently asked questions (FAQ)
Is it safe to enter bank card details in an emulator?
Inputting data in official applications (for example, banking clients or Google Play) inside trusted emulators is generally safe, since encryption is used. However, it is not recommended to store large amounts of money or enter card data in suspicious applications downloaded from third-party sites, since the emulator does not have the same degree of hardware protection as a physical smartphone.
Is it possible to run the emulator without administrator rights?
No, for the emulator to work correctly, you need access to low-level system functions, such as creating virtual network adapters and management virtualization. Without administrator rights, installing drivers is impossible, and the app will not be able to initialize the virtual machine.
Why does the emulator slow down even on a powerful PC?
Most often, the reason lies in disabled virtualization in the BIOS or the emulator running on an integrated video card instead of a discrete one. Check in the Windows graphics settings to ensure that the emulator uses a high-performance GPU, and make sure that VT-x or AMD-V technology is enabled in the BIOS.
How to completely remove the emulator, including all traces?
Simply uninstalling it through the Control Panel may not be enough. After the standard uninstallation, check the app Files and AppData folders for residual emulator files. It is also recommended to clear the registry of entries associated with the app name if you plan to reinstall it completely.
Does the emulator support gamepads?
Yes, most modern emulators have native support for gamepads (Xbox, PlayStation, universal USB controllers). The device is usually detected automatically, and you can customize the buttons in the control settings menu by mapping the gamepad buttons to virtual screen touches.
